<noscript draggable="6visyh"></noscript><center id="uqbqip"></center><kbd dropzone="as9tsc"></kbd><dfn dir="ya9hka"></dfn><strong dir="500g_s"></strong><sub draggable="de3epw"></sub><map dir="76gizo"></map>

TP钱包ETH取消交易全解析:从高级身份验证到资产曲线的系统应对

以下内容为对“TP钱包ETH取消交易”的详细分析与可执行思路梳理。由于区块链交易在链上是否可被“取消”取决于nonce与矿工/网络状态,本质上通常是“替换(speed up / cancel)”而非简单撤销。你可以把目标理解为:让同一nonce下的交易以更高优先级确认,从而使原交易失效或永远不被打包。

一、高级身份验证(先守住账号与授权)

1)确认你操作的是正确的账户

- 打开TP钱包,进入ETH相关地址详情,确认当前连接/使用的地址与要取消交易的发送地址一致。

- 如果你曾在多设备登录或导入多个钱包,极易取消错账户的交易。

2)检查交易是否来自“已授权的合约/路由”

- 若交易由DApp或合约代发(例如授权、交换、路由聚合),取消逻辑通常要看nonce归属与合约调用。

- 建议在链上或TP钱包交易详情中核对:to地址、value、数据data长度与类型。

3)提高安全性:避免钓鱼与伪造取消入口

- 不要在未知网页输入助记词/私钥。

- 取消操作前,先确认TP钱包内置界面与交易哈希是否匹配;不要相信“发一笔新交易就能撤回”的来路不明教程。

二、代币维护(合约交互后别忽视代币层状态)

1)区分“原交易是ETH还是代币交换”

- 若原交易为普通转账:可通过同nonce替换来“取消/加速”。

- 若原交易是代币兑换、路由调用:即使替换原nonce,合约层状态(例如授权、路由执行、滑点失败/成功)可能已经发生部分效果,因此需要关注事件日志与余额变化。

2)授权(Allowance)维护

- 很多操作依赖ERC20授权。若原交易是授权或授权后立刻交换,取消替换后仍建议检查Allowance是否已成功改变。

- 在代币合约页面查看授权额度(或通过链上读取),必要时可再次执行“降低到0/重新授权”的维护策略。

3)余额与Gas费用预估

- “取消”交易也需要支付Gas。确保你的ETH余额足以覆盖替换交易的Gas(尤其是网络拥堵时)。

三、合约监控(看nonce、看状态,而不是只看“待确认”)

1)确认交易状态的关键字段

- 交易哈希:确认原交易是否已进入链上(已确认/已失败会有状态)。

- nonce:取消/替换必须使用同一个nonce。

- gasPrice / maxFeePerGas / maxPriorityFeePerGas:替换交易需更高优先级,才可能先被打包。

2)合约监控与事件核验

- 若是合约交互交易(to不是你的EOA,或者data有复杂调用),建议在区块浏览器查看:

- transaction receipt(是否已成功/失败)

- logs/events是否已经产生

- 若receipt已存在,说明“取消”将不再回到起点:你只能看后续是否需要补救(例如二次交换、退款逻辑不存在则需重新规划)。

3)当交易卡住时的策略

- 常见表现:TP显示“pending”,链上交易未被打包且gas竞价不足。

- 处理逻辑:同nonce提交更高gas的替换交易,使原交易被“竞速压制”。

四、新兴技术管理(EIP-1559与钱包实现差异)

1)理解EIP-1559参数体系

- 现代ETH交易多使用maxFeePerGas与maxPriorityFeePerGas。

- 取消/替换交易通常要提高这些参数,使其在当下的base fee与优先费环境下更可能被打包。

2)钱包端实现差异

- 不同钱包/不同版本界面可能将“取消交易”实现为:

- 发送一个同nonce、to为“自我地址”或“零价值”的转账。

- 或直接“Speed Up/替换”某笔未确认交易。

- 若TP钱包当前不提供“取消”,也可能提供“加速/替换”。本质同一思路。

3)网络拥堵下的参数管理

- 拥堵时,base fee波动大;单纯提高gas可能仍需多次调整。

- 建议不要盲目多次频繁替换导致gas成本失控:先观察若干分钟的链上base fee与同类交易的打包速度。

五、智能算法(用“规则+反馈”做最优替换)

1)目标函数:以尽可能低成本换取“先确认”

- 你要最大化:替换成功概率。

- 同时约束:总Gas支出与时间成本。

2)可执行的智能策略(半自动)

- 计算nonce:从原交易详情复制nonce。

- 选择替换类型:

- 若要“取消”:替换为to=自己的EOA,value=0或最小值(取决于钱包策略)。

- 若要“加速”:替换同nonce但保持to与data一致(等价于加速原意)。

- 提升优先级:

- 先按当前建议gas上浮一定比例(例如在钱包“建议值”基础上加一档)。

- 若多次仍未打包,再逐步上调。

3)反馈循环:根据链上观察决定下一次

- 观察频率:每隔1-3次区块(或数分钟)查看一次。

- 判断:

- 若替换交易已确认,结束流程。

- 若原交易或替换交易失败但已上链,进入“合约监控/补救”阶段。

六、资产曲线(从财务视角跟踪风险与成本)

1)为什么要看“资产曲线”

- 取消/替换会改变你ETH与代币的净值曲线:

- 你可能花了Gas但没获得预期执行。

- 或因nonce替换导致操作顺序改变。

2)建议的曲线维度

- 余额曲线:ETH余额(随替换交易减少)。

- 资产曲线:代币余额(是否因为原交易的部分执行已变化)。

- 成本曲线:累积Gas支出 vs 预计成功成本。

- 风险曲线:pending时间越长,机会成本越高。

3)落地做法

- 在操作前记录:原交易的gas参数、预计费用、当前ETH余额。

- 每次替换后更新:已花费Gas与当前pending数量。

- 若连续替换多次且仍无法确认,通常需要停下来评估是否应接受原交易结果,转向补救策略(例如重新发起正确的交易,而不是无休止竞价)。

结论与操作前清单

- 取消本质是“同nonce替换”,不是链上撤回。

- 关键点:确认身份与地址正确;核对nonce;理解EIP-1559参数;对合约交易进行事件核验;用反馈策略控制成本;用资产曲线衡量风险与收益。

如果你愿意,我可以根据你提供的:原交易哈希/nonce/当前gas参数/TP钱包是否提供“取消或加速”、以及该交易是转账还是合约交互,给出更贴合的替换参数与操作步骤(不需要提供私钥)。

作者:墨羽审链发布时间:2026-06-02 00:48:35

评论

NovaLink

这篇把“取消=替换nonce”的逻辑讲得很清楚,尤其是合约交互那段提醒很到位。

秋风链痕

资产曲线的视角让我意识到:一直加速不一定是最优,得有成本上限。

ChainWhisper

高级身份验证+不要乱点取消入口,算是把安全坑先排雷了。

小海豚搬砖

合约监控提到查receipt和logs,这点比只看TP显示pending靠谱多了。

ByteAtlas

智能算法那部分用反馈循环来指导gas上调,思路很实用。

晨雾Zero

新兴技术管理里EIP-1559参数理解得很到位,不然很多人只会盲抬gasPrice。

相关阅读
<acronym dir="k6w_o"></acronym><font dir="xbsjn"></font>